- Summary:
- The intriguing and enduring tale of the free-spirited Queen Mary, who refused to accept the constraints of her birth and position. Watkins recreates Mary's world--the landscapes, the palaces, the courtly culture and the details of the domestic scene. Includes a wealth of historical illustrations and specially commissioned photos.
